If you’ve ever wondered if SOLIDWORKS can help bring your digital ideas into reality through additive manufacturing, the answer is a resounding yes! Join us for a look at how we can help turn your SOLIDWORKS models into physical ones. Thanks to SOLIDWORKS’ Print3D command, users can define the critical aspects of their printer, the orientation of the part to be printed, the thickness of layers, plus more that allow users to prepare a model without ever leaving the software.
